Montenegro's Supreme Court in Podgorica has determined that Terra's founder, Do Kwon, will be extradited to the United States, according to news outlet Pobjeda.

This extradition decision was finalized in November 2023 but left open the question of whether Kwon would be handed over to the USA or South Korea. The decision ultimately rested with Andrej Milovic, the Minister of Justice.

The court had previously confirmed that all criteria for Kwon's extradition were fulfilled, with Kwon himself consenting to a fast-tracked extradition process.

Do Kwon's attorney, Goran Rodic, insisted that Kwon should legally be extradited to South Korea first.
All the legal grounds, including the European Extradition Convention, our bilateral agreement with America, and Montenegro's Law on International Legal Assistance, fully indicate that Do Kwon should be extradited to South Korea once such a decision is made,
Rodic remarked.
Montenegro's Justice Minister, Andrej Milovic, explained that the decision favoring the USA was influenced predominantly by political considerations.
The USA is our primary international ally, and we are eager to finalize a bilateral extradition treaty to establish a legal framework for future extraditions,
Minister Milovic stated.
Previously, Do Kwon was arrested on March 23, 2023, at Podgorica airport while attempting to fly to Dubai with forged documents.
